Interview : Robert Hall and Leslie Kimball of Responsibility . org

by KYLE SWARTZ

Promoting safe consumption practices remains a critical component of the alcohol industry . Helping lead that effort is The Foundation for Advancing Alcohol Responsibility ( Responsibility . org ). Supported by 13 of America ’ s leading distillers , Responsibility . org works to eliminate drunk driving and underage drinking , while promoting responsible decision-making regarding beverage alcohol . We recently spoke with the organization ’ s newly appointed chair , Robert Hall , and executive director , Leslie Kimball .

What programs are you most proud of at Responsibility . org ? LK : It ’ s impossible to pick just one . It ’ s like asking a parent to choose a favorite child . But as a parent myself , the programs that Responsibility . org has in the underage drinking prevention space leave a great impact . Our Ask , Listen , Learn underage drinking prevention program has been around for more than 20 years . It ’ s gone through pivots and iterations to ensure it aligns with science and what kids are doing , learning and experiencing .
We always try to meet parents where they are , so we also have a robust network of content creators and parents who know all about the importance of conversations — starting them early and having them often . RH : Our newest program is Responsibility Works . This is an alcohol education program for anyone . It educates people about alcohol in general : What a standard size drink is and how alcohol affects the body . This is a fantastic tool to educate people throughout the country to make them more aware and therefore more responsible when it comes to decisions about alcohol in the real world . LK : I ’ ll just add that the Virtual Bar is something I think every adult of legal drinking age should have on their phone . It ’ s not intuitive for some to understand how alcohol affects their [ blood alcohol content ], so this is a tool that we can all use to help us understand how alcohol beverages will affect not only our BAC but also how that makes us feel . It takes your weight , gender , height and food and beverage intake , and gives you an estimate of how your blood alcohol content may be affected . I think it ’ s a great safety and planning tool .
